Adsorption of Surfactant Lipids by Single-Walled Carbon Nanotubes in Mouse Lung upon Pharyngeal Aspiration: Role in Uptake by Macrophages

The pulmonary route represents one of the most important portals of entry for nanoparticles into the body.
